Beschreibung
Derided as simple, dismissed as inferior to film, characterized as a vast wasteland, television nonetheless exerts an undeniable, apparently inescapable power. The secret of televisions success may lie in the narrative complexities underlying its seeming simplicity, complexities the author unmasks in her analysis here.

Über den Autor
Kristin Thompson is an honorary fellow in the Communication Arts Department at the University of Wisconsin-Madison.
